Types of Patio Side Shade Covers
Patio side shade covers come in a variety of styles, each with its unique features and benefits. Understanding these types will help you choose the perfect one for your patio.

1. **Retractable Awnings**: Retractable awnings are a popular choice due to their versatility and convenience. They can be extended or retracted at the push of a button, allowing you to control the amount of shade as needed. These awnings are available in manual or motorized versions and come in a wide range of fabrics and colors.
Manual vs Motorized Retractable Awnings

Manual retractable awnings are cost-effective and easy to operate, making them an excellent choice for those on a budget. Motorized awnings, on the other hand, offer convenience and can be controlled remotely or even set on a timer. They are ideal for those who prioritize ease of use and want to integrate their awning with smart home systems.
2. **Pergolas**: Pergolas are freestanding structures that provide both shade and a sense of enclosure. They can be built from wood, vinyl, or metal and often feature open lattice roofs that allow some sunlight to filter through. Pergolas can be further enhanced with retractable canopies or climbing plants for added shade and privacy.
Pergolas with Retractable Canopies

Combining a pergola with a retractable canopy offers the best of both worlds - the structural appeal of a pergola with the adjustable shade of an awning. This hybrid design allows you to enjoy your patio space in various weather conditions and at different times of the day.
3. **Patio Umbrellas**: Patio umbrellas are a portable and affordable option for providing shade. They come in various sizes, shapes, and materials, from traditional cantilever umbrellas to offset and market umbrellas. Some high-end models even offer features like UV protection and wind resistance.
Cantilever vs Offset vs Market Umbrellas

Cantilever umbrellas are ideal for small spaces as they don't require a base on the patio. Offset umbrellas are great for providing shade over tables, while market umbrellas offer the most coverage and are perfect for larger gatherings. Consider your specific needs and space constraints when choosing the right patio umbrella.
Installing Patio Side Shade Covers
















Installing a patio side shade cover is a rewarding DIY project that can significantly enhance your outdoor living space. Here are some tips to ensure a smooth and successful installation.
1. **Measure Accurately**: Before purchasing your shade cover, measure the width, depth, and height of your patio to ensure the cover you choose fits perfectly. Also, consider the height of your patio furniture to ensure there's enough clearance.
Wall-Mounted vs Freestanding Shade Covers
Wall-mounted shade covers are ideal for patios adjacent to your home, as they can be secured to the wall for added stability. Freestanding shade covers, on the other hand, are perfect for standalone patios or those with limited wall space. They typically come with their own support system or can be attached to existing structures like posts or railings.
2. **Prepare the Installation Area**: Clear the installation area of any debris or obstacles. If you're installing a wall-mounted shade cover, ensure the wall is clean, dry, and free of any obstructions. For freestanding covers, level the ground and remove any sharp objects that could damage the cover or cause injury.
3. **Follow the Manufacturer's Instructions**: Each shade cover comes with its own set of installation instructions. Carefully read and follow these guidelines to ensure a safe and secure installation. If you're unsure about any aspect of the installation, don't hesitate to contact the manufacturer or consult a professional.
